Output 1166e33aad7401429b3c5bc1c2bfba7900e822f8d7e981c627fa011e0e1f5c51:8

value
77961877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81177d6e2a33ace94c87ec4065bde28c292991e OP_EQUAL
address
3MPUogiVFi2bqYzw4FCGnHc3chNMqKazCd
transaction
1166e33aad7401429b3c5bc1c2bfba7900e822f8d7e981c627fa011e0e1f5c51
confirmations
340141
spent
true